Abstract

207,244. Peters & Co., Ltd., G. D., Holey, W. H., and Brackenbury, A. G. Aug. 21, 1922. Valves actuated by fluid under control of auxiliary valves.-Apparatus for the automatic regulation of air ejectors or exhausters, especially for brakes of trains, comprises a diaphragm open at one side to atmospheric pressure and on the other to the vacuum reservoir and subject to a spring, a steam chest immediately below the diaphragm chamber, and a valve carried by the diaphragm and having its steam passing through the top of the steam chest to control the steam supply from the chest to a piston cylinder, the piston being connected with the stem of a valve controlling the admission of steam to the exhauster. The ejector governor shown comprises a diaphragm 3, Fig. 1, held between the flanges of a dome 1 which is connected through a pipe 30 with the vacuum train pipe of a .brake system, and a perforated plate or spider 2 supported on a steam chest 4 secured to a cylinder 5 in which works a piston 6 connected to a valve 7 which controls the ejector steam supply. The piston is pressed upwards by a spring, and is formed with a small hole 11 through which the steam passes which required to an exhaust pipe or fitting 12. A pin valve 14 connected to the diaphragm controls a port 13 in the steam chest, leading to the upper side of the piston. A spring 17 adjusted by a plug 18 acts on the upper surface of the diaphragm. When a sufficient vacuum obtains in the pipe 30 the valve 14 is raised, allowing live steam to pass through a connection 20 to a pipe 22 and the chest to the space above the piston 5 which is depressed, closing the valve 7 on its seat and preventing the passage of steam to the space 24 above the valve, which is in communication with the main and pilot ejectors 25, 26. The train pipe is connected at the part 27 with a vacuum chamber 28 from the top, of which the pipe 30 is led to the space above the diaphragm. A handle 32 controls a valve 35, Fig. 3, leading from the space 24 to the stem space 4 of the main ejector by means of an arm 33, and also controls an air admission or brake application valve through an arm 34, Fig. 1. The steam supply to the pilot ejector may be shut off by a screw-down valve 39, Fig. 3, actuated by a handle 40. The air withdrawn by the pilot ejector flows from the chamber 28, Fig. 1, past check valve 45 to the ejector and a like valve is provided for the main ejector. The governor apparatus may be mounted oh the live steam supply pipe in place of being mounted on the inlet chamber 20 of the exhauster. Two governors may be employed, controlling the main and pilot ejectors respectively, or one governor may control the main steam supply and another may control the passage between the cut-off valve of the first governor and the jets of the main ejector.
